Sniffies 101: Everything you need to know about the gay cruising app

Sniffies is a map-based hookup platform that launched in 2018.

Is Sniffies safe?

Like any hookup app, especially one that emphasizes anonymity and public cruising, Sniffies comes with risks. It’s faster, raunchier, and designed for immediacy.
